We Own It!The purpose of this job is to provide overall direction and control of the day-to-day field construction activities on assigned project, including sequencing and coordination of the crafts in an efficient manner, allocations of manpower, materials, equipment utilization, overall management of the safety plan for the project, overall construction quality, site logistics, etc.Responsibilities:1. Leads and oversees the day-to-day field construction activities on assigned jobsite2. In charge of the overall safety of the jobsite, including the implementation of the safety plans and procedures3. Reviews record documents, submittals, shop drawings, and schedule to determine the nature and scope of the project, the materials to be utilized, manpower requirements (by craft) for each construction phase, equipment needs, etc.4. Along with the project manager, plans the physical layout of the jobsite to use effectively all available space; initiates startup activities, which include site security preparations, placement of office trailers, utility hookups, etc.5. Designates areas for cranes and hoists, building materials storage, parking, etc.6. Directs field engineers in the initial survey and layout of the jobsite; ensures that all dimensional control lines and elevations are correct and verified by certified third-party site surveyors before foundation work begins7. Plans the daily and weekly activities for each craft, including detailed schedule. forecasts, within the scope of the overall construction schedule; provides detailed technical instructions for each foreman to ensure a clear understanding of the work, methods, manpower resources, and expected completion date; works with the project office staff to resolve any ambiguities in plans and drawings before construction begins8. Along with the senior most superintendent, the superintendent establishes procedures for the ordering of self-performed building materials, supplies, and small tools from approved suppliers 9. Inspects all field construction work in progress, including work that is subcontracted, and ensures that uniformly high-quality workmanship is maintained during each construction segment; supervises or appoints staff as appropriate to supervise all activities performed on the jobsite regardless of the day or time of the performance of the work, pointing out deficiencies promptly with responsible parties and following up to ensure that deficiencies are corrected10. Provides technical guidance and assistance in resolving day-to-day construction problems; investigates alternative work methods and materials to improve efficiency and work quality; works closely with architects, engineers, and consulting firms to resolve problems11. Assists the senior most superintendent in evaluating schedule and cost impacts12. Assists the senior most superintendent in the development of the manpower projection chart; monitors weekly labor costs for accuracy and conformance with established budget and takes corrective action to improve productivity when labor costs exceed expected norms; investigates reasons for delays in the construction schedule, adjusting leadership, crew sizes, equipment, etc. as necessary to ensure timely completion of the project13. Assists the senior most superintendent in the development of the equipment projection chart and monitors equipment use, maintenance, and cost throughout the project14. Ensures compliance with all federal, state, and local laws, ordinances and codes relating to construction activities, including company policies and procedures dealing with employment, terminations, compensation, labor/management relations, etc.15. Manages scheduling of all governmental inspections of all work necessary to obtain a certificate of occupancy16. Assumes overall responsibility for the health and safety of employees, including designation of first aid areas, emergency treatment facilities, accompanying OSHA inspectors on jobsite visits, correcting observed safety hazards, etc.17. Establishes and maintains a good working relationship with owners and owner representatives, architects, consulting firms, and other parties with financial interest in the project; attempts to resolve problems at the lowest practical level through direct negotiations with concerned individuals18. Performs a variety of tasks associated with project completion, including close-out punch lists, demobilization, as-built documents, etc.19. Maintains a detailed and accurate daily report of all activity associated with field construction activities20.
